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Booted Macaque | Ecuador Cochran Frog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) | Centrolenidae |
| Genus | Macaca | Nymphargus |
| Species | Macaca ochreata | Nymphargus griffithsi |
Evolutionary Relationship
Booted Macaque and Ecuador Cochran Frog share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
